Making text size proportional on images in photoshop

  • July 27, 2018
  • 5 replies
  • 3641 views

Hi,

I am creating football player banners in photoshop and using 3 different poses. As the focal lengths are different between the poses, when I place text on the image {player name) it appears as different sizes between photos due to the differences in focal length and player names  even though the text is all the same font and size on each photo/banner.

Is there any way to make the text size proportional photo to photo so it appears consistent in size between images?

    How do you have Type set in Preferences?  Set it to a linear size like millimetres.  Avoid Points which can lead to problems with very large pixel size canvas

    Set Rulers to the same unit (mm) by right clicking inside either ruler.

    With these settings, no mater what the pixel size of the image, if the rulers show it to be — for instance — 150mm or 15cm, and you create a type layer of 10mm, you know it is one tenth the height of the canvas.

    ​Note: the rulers below are set to mm

    [EDIT]  If you want to do this with an Action, and have the same relative placement (position) with different image/canvas sizes, then I then the trick is to have the rulers set to Percent when you record the action

    If you have different resolutions (Image > Image > Size > Resolution) it can make the difference. For text to appear visually the same in size you must pay attention to the resolution, For example: type size 10pt in document with 300 ppi resolution must be set to 42pt in the document with 72 ppi to appear same in size (dimensions or space which occupies on screen).

    Either ensure that all your images have same resolution or change text size manually.
